Hadoop 3.1.1 Проблемы с именным узлом Mac OS

На моем компьютере был запущен Hadoop, но у меня были проблемы с компилятором, поэтому я удалил его и начал все заново.

Я следил за этой настройкой: https://www.guru99.com/how-to-install-hadoop.html

Когда я запускаю $HADOOP_HOME/bin/hdfs namenode -format Терминал ничего не возвращает.

Заранее спасибо.

Примечание. В этой ссылке есть несколько шагов, которые не нужны в Hadoop 2.x и определенно не в Hadoop3, но почему вы ожидаете, что команда форматирования будет иметь какой-либо вывод? Показанное изображение, похоже, показывает вывод start-dfs, а не вывод формата.

OneCricketeer 11.10.2018 01:24

Я не получаю никаких результатов для моих команд, специфичных для Hadoop. Даже версия hadoop не дает мне никаких результатов. Я должен получить подтверждение или сообщение о запуске и завершении работы.

Niyya Té 11.10.2018 01:32

Возможно, в вашей папке загрузки Hadoop отсутствует файл log4j.properties.

OneCricketeer 11.10.2018 01:34

у меня есть файл на usr/local/Cellar/hadoop/3.1.1/libexec/hadoop/, который я скачал с помощью homebrew

Niyya Té 11.10.2018 01:38

Хм. Несколько недель назад я попробовал формат namenode из Homebrew на 3.1.1, и у меня он отлично сработал. Я не могу вспомнить, был ли вывод или нет, но, запустив службы, он вошел в консоль

OneCricketeer 11.10.2018 01:46

Именно по этому вопросу был stackoverflow.com/a/52531871/2308683

OneCricketeer 11.10.2018 01:47

моя консоль показывает только то, что я открыл терминал. Но никакой службы не пялился. Как вы загружали и настраивали?

Niyya Té 11.10.2018 01:48
brew install hadoop. Я не помню, чтобы я менял что-либо, кроме некоторых файлов XML и файла hadoop-env.sh для настроек Java
OneCricketeer 11.10.2018 01:49
Как установить PHP на Mac
Как установить PHP на Mac
PHP - это популярный язык программирования, который используется для разработки веб-приложений. Если вы используете Mac и хотите разрабатывать...
0
8
437
3

Ответы 3

У меня была такая же проблема, и я исправил ее, выполнив следующие действия.

Перейдите в файл etc для настройки файлов hadoop-env, core-site, mapred, yarn.

Измените на sbin, чтобы сделать форматирование и обеденное обслуживание HDS

Вы можете уточнить, как это изменить?

ikel 24.03.2019 09:04

запустите с sudo, вы получите результат Например

sudo hdfs namenode -format

Вам необходимо убедиться, что вы уже настроили файлы hadoop-env, core-site, mapred, yarn, а затем обработали их в формате namenode.

Другие вопросы по теме